CVE-2011-2709

6.2 · MEDIUM
Published Jun 21, 2012 umich CWE-264 EPSS 0.44% (37th pctl)

Overview

CVE-2011-2709 is a medium-severity vulnerability affecting umich libgssglue. It was published on June 21, 2012 and has a CVSS 2.0 base score of 6.2 (MEDIUM).

This vulnerability has a CVSS 2.0 base score of 6.2, rated MEDIUM. It requires local or adjacent network access to exploit. No authentication or special privileges are required for exploitation.

Technical Description

libgssapi and libgssglue before 0.4 do not properly check privileges, which allows local users to load untrusted configuration files and execute arbitrary code via the GSSAPI_MECH_CONF environment variable, as demonstrated using mount.nfs.
